Footballers urged to respect Guildhall

Young people playing football close to the Guildhall in Londonderry are being asked to take care they do not cause damage to the historic building.

Sergeant Cathal Pearce, of the City Centre Neighbourhood Policing Team, said that in recent times several windows of the Guildhall had been damaged.

“Given their style and age, the cost of repairs to the windows can be considerable,” he said.

“Damage has been caused as a result of football being played in the square in the early evenings and at school holiday times.

“This is something police will be paying attention to at the relevant times.

“We will also seek to identify and prosecute offences of criminal damage.”
